Here is the plain-language version of when you can get a refund. The full detail is in the ticket purchase terms, and that is the version that binds. The short story: the venue is the seller and sets the refund policy for its event, and findout processes any refund on the venue's behalf.
The event is cancelled
You get everything back, including the booking fee: the full amount you paid returns to the card you paid with. findout processes the refund once the venue provides the funds. Refunding the fee on cancellation is not the industry norm; on findout it is the rule.
The event is postponed or rescheduled
Your ticket stays valid for the new date, so you do not need to do anything. If you cannot make the new date, you can ask for a refund of the face value within 14 days of the new date being announced. After that the ticket is still valid but non-refundable.
The event is materially changed
If something central changes, like the headline act, the date, or the venue, you can ask for a refund of the face value. Smaller changes do not count, like support acts, set times, the running order, or the weather at an outdoor event.
You change your mind
Tickets are for a specific date, so a change of mind is not refundable, and the 14-day online cooling-off period does not apply to dated leisure events. This does not affect your refund if the event is cancelled or materially changed.
About the booking fee
The booking fee pays for the booking service, which is delivered as soon as your ticket is issued, so it is non-refundable when the ticket price is refunded for any other reason. The one exception is a cancelled event: cancellation refunds everything, booking fee included. See our fees for what the fee is and what it covers.
